Types of Products For Land Clearings
Brush Cutters
Ideal for clearing dense brush and small trees, these tools attach to tractors or skid steers for efficient vegetation removal.
Tree Felling Wedges
Used to safely fell large trees, these wedges help control the direction of the fall and prevent equipment damage.
Hydraulic Tree Stump Grinders
Designed to grind down tree stumps efficiently, making way for new landscaping or construction.
Skid Steer Attachments
Various attachments like rakes, rippers, and buckets tailored for land clearing tasks on skid steers.
Excavator Rippers
Heavy-duty rippers attach to excavators to break up tough soil and roots during clearing operations.
Chainsaws
Portable power tools suitable for cutting trees, branches, and clearing small to medium vegetation.
Handheld Brush Cutters
Lightweight tools for detailed vegetation removal around structures and in tight spaces.
Rakes and Grapples
Attachments for gathering debris, logs, and brush efficiently after cutting or uprooting.
Loader Buckets
Heavy-duty buckets for removing soil, rocks, and debris during land preparation.
Mulchers
Equipment designed to chip and mulch vegetation, reducing biomass and clearing land quickly.
Rippers and Tillers
Tools for breaking up compacted soil and preparing land for planting or construction.
Rock Pickers
Machines for removing rocks from soil, facilitating smoother land for development.
Felling Wedges
Tools to assist in controlled tree felling, ensuring safety and precision.
Hydraulic Breakers
Attach to excavators for breaking up large rocks and concrete during site clearing.
Land Grading Equipment
Machines used to level and contour land after clearing for proper drainage and layout.

Different land clearing methods and tools cater to various scales and types of terrain. Handheld tools are suitable for smaller jobs or detailed work around existing structures. Heavy machinery, on the other hand, is designed for larger areas and more challenging conditions, offering power and speed. The choice of equipment depends on factors such as the density of vegetation, the type of terrain, and the project's scope.
Safety considerations and ease of operation are also vital when selecting products. Proper training, protective gear, and adherence to safety protocols help prevent accidents. Additionally, considering the durability and maintenance requirements of equipment ensures long-term usability. Key Buying Considerations
- Assess the scale of your project to determine the appropriate equipment size and power.
- Consider the type of vegetation and terrain to select suitable tools and attachments.
- Evaluate compatibility with existing machinery or whether additional equipment purchase is necessary.
- Prioritize safety features and ease of operation for yourself or your team.
- Check the durability and build quality of tools to ensure long-term performance.
- Review maintenance requirements and availability of replacement parts.
- Determine if additional accessories or attachments are needed for specific tasks.
- Consider your budget and the potential for equipment rental versus purchase.
- Research local regulations and safety standards relevant to land clearing in New Braunfels, TX.
- Think about storage and transportation logistics for larger equipment or attachments.
- Look for versatile tools that can handle multiple tasks to maximize investment value.
- Evaluate the availability of technical support or customer service from suppliers.
- Assess the noise levels and environmental considerations during operation.
- Review user feedback and ratings to gauge reliability and performance.
- Ensure proper safety gear and training are accessible for safe operation.
